-
Notifications
You must be signed in to change notification settings - Fork 4
/
Copy pathtrace.sav
101 lines (101 loc) · 2.48 KB
/
trace.sav
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
[*]
[*] GTKWave Analyzer v3.3.98 (w)1999-2019 BSI
[*] Wed Jan 9 17:55:22 2019
[*]
[dumpfile] "/home/xerpi/Desktop/tiny5/tiny5/trace.fst"
[dumpfile_mtime] "Wed Jan 9 17:52:50 2019"
[dumpfile_size] 17602
[savefile] "/home/xerpi/Desktop/tiny5/tiny5/trace.sav"
[timestart] 24
[size] 1920 1025
[pos] -1 -1
*-2.000000 30 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1 -1
[treeopen] TOP.
[treeopen] TOP.top.
[treeopen] TOP.top.datapath.
[treeopen] TOP.top.datapath.control_unit.
[treeopen] TOP.top.datapath.regfile.
[treeopen] TOP.top.datapath.store_buffer.
[sst_width] 275
[signals_width] 389
[sst_expanded] 1
[sst_vpaned_height] 438
@28
TOP.top.reset_i
TOP.top.clk_i
@800200
-Pipeline registers
@22
TOP.top.datapath.pc[31:0]
TOP.top.datapath.id_reg[64:0]
TOP.top.datapath.ex_reg[201:0]
TOP.top.datapath.mem_reg[160:0]
TOP.top.datapath.wb_reg[150:0]
@1000200
-Pipeline registers
@800200
-Hazards
@28
TOP.top.datapath.control_unit.ex_data_hazard
TOP.top.datapath.control_unit.mem_data_hazard
TOP.top.datapath.control_unit.wb_data_hazard
TOP.top.datapath.control_unit.data_hazard
TOP.top.datapath.control_unit.control_hazard
@1000200
-Hazards
@22
TOP.top.datapath.next_pc[31:0]
@800200
-Registers
@22
TOP.top.datapath.regfile.registers(1)[31:0]
TOP.top.datapath.regfile.registers(2)[31:0]
TOP.top.datapath.regfile.registers(3)[31:0]
TOP.top.datapath.regfile.registers(4)[31:0]
TOP.top.datapath.regfile.registers(5)[31:0]
TOP.top.datapath.regfile.registers(6)[31:0]
TOP.top.datapath.regfile.registers(29)[31:0]
TOP.top.datapath.regfile.registers(30)[31:0]
@1000200
-Registers
@800200
-Bypasses
@28
TOP.top.datapath.control_unit.ex_alu_out_to_reg1_bypass
@1000200
-Bypasses
@800200
-Store buffer
@22
TOP.top.datapath.store_buffer.put_addr_i[31:0]
TOP.top.datapath.store_buffer.put_data_i[31:0]
TOP.top.datapath.store_buffer.put_size_i[1:0]
@28
TOP.top.datapath.store_buffer.put_enable_i
@22
TOP.top.datapath.store_buffer.head[1:0]
TOP.top.datapath.store_buffer.tail[1:0]
@28
TOP.top.datapath.store_buffer.full
TOP.top.datapath.store_buffer.empty
@29
TOP.top.datapath.store_buffer.advance
@22
TOP.top.datapath.store_buffer.entries(0)[65:0]
TOP.top.datapath.store_buffer.entries(1)[65:0]
TOP.top.datapath.store_buffer.entries(2)[65:0]
TOP.top.datapath.store_buffer.entries(3)[65:0]
@1000200
-Store buffer
@800200
-CSR
@22
TOP.top.datapath.csr.reg_cycle[63:0]
TOP.top.datapath.csr.reg_instret[63:0]
TOP.top.datapath.csr.reg_time[63:0]
@1000200
-CSR
@22
TOP.top.memory_bus.rd_data[255:0]
[pattern_trace] 1
[pattern_trace] 0